Transaction 0052a1808ec15377be0814dfab54155c2ae39dc702cdf5a8b2552602887e7c28

1 Input
2 Outputs
  • 0052a1808ec15377be0814dfab54155c2ae39dc702cdf5a8b2552602887e7c28:0
  • value  558077143
    address  1EWF22yFGusLzgKV7Dk9dV8n62XpRRTXsb
  • 0052a1808ec15377be0814dfab54155c2ae39dc702cdf5a8b2552602887e7c28:1
  • value  80100000
    address  1KesZMUqYMkh3W881JGfyyhD9GkhX96wY5